Output 8597f59fc70cd699799fd4d458cdb3c2007aa3e25767faa248512c64e8a73eb7:1

value
63485940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1386f8aba47d055f516418ef9893af6c33f17c7 OP_EQUAL
address
ABWXVhoDn8dbL3YpQymSTRFJjcHzCvEnkJ
transaction
8597f59fc70cd699799fd4d458cdb3c2007aa3e25767faa248512c64e8a73eb7